If they were specially designed for the 3DS, no. There is a small tab jutting out of the side of 3DS games making them unplayable on a DSi. Even if you could fit the cards into a DSi, they would not work because they use 3D technology the DSi cannot utilize. DSi games will be playable on the 3DS though.

They are barely any different. The DSi XL has better screens and a longer battery life, but it's not easy to carry because it's much bigger. Since the DSi is cheaper, I would recommend that, unless you have problems with your sight, or if you would use it regularly with others (the XL is designed for other people to watch you play)
